About this map

Energy extraction and ranching infrastructure define this corner of Campbell County during the early 1970s. The landscape is marked by a network of industrial sites, including a Strip Mine and numerous Oil Wells, Gas Wells, and Drill Holes scattered across the terrain. These features reflect the intensifying mineral exploration in the Powder River Basin at the time. A notable Landing Strip and the Pipeline provide further evidence of the logistical requirements of this remote industrial activity.
